What is Trauma Therapy and How Does it Work?
Trauma, Therapy Talk Laurel Roberts-Meese Trauma, Therapy Talk Laurel Roberts-Meese

What is Trauma Therapy and How Does it Work?

Trauma therapy aims to help relieve the suffering of individuals who have experienced trauma. Trauma can encompass a wide range of experiences, from abuse or neglect to witnessing or experiencing natural disasters, as well as smaller experiences that build up over time. Trauma therapy can help individuals work through these symptoms and embark on a path of healing
